Acodeco Inspects Scales and Prices for Seafood in Panama

The Authority for Consumer Protection and Competition Defense (Acodeco) conducted inspections of scales and visible prices for seafood at the capital's market, as well as at other distribution centers located in various parts of the country. During today's inspection at the Seafood Market, staff from Acodeco's Metrology Department reviewed a total of 13 scales, which satisfactorily passed the technical tests, ensuring that consumers receive the correct weight in their purchases. These actions are part of the operations the agency carries out during Holy Week, a season when fish and seafood consumption increases significantly. The objective is to verify compliance with consumer protection standards and promote transparent commercial practices. Acodeco reminds consumers that the prices of seafood are subject to market supply and demand.
